Репозиторий ALT Linux backports/2.4
Последнее обновление: 9 июля 2008 | Пакетов: 497 | Посещений: 1633565
 поиск   регистрация   авторизация 
 
Группа :: Графические оболочки/KDE
Пакет: kdebase

 Главная   Изменения   Спек   Патчи   Загрузить   Bugs and FR 

Патч: 3.2.3-man-add-encoding.patch


--- kdebase-3.2.3/kioslave/man/man2html.cpp~	2004-06-07 11:32:17 +0400
+++ kdebase-3.2.3/kioslave/man/man2html.cpp	2004-06-29 21:58:05 +0400
@@ -117,6 +117,7 @@
 #include <sys/time.h>
 #include <errno.h>
 
+#include <qtextcodec.h>
 #include <qvaluestack.h>
 #include <qstring.h>
 #include <qptrlist.h>
@@ -2971,6 +2972,9 @@ static char *scan_request(char *c)
 			out_html(scan_troff(wordlist[0], 0, NULL));
 		    out_html( " Manpage</TITLE>\n");
                     out_html( "<link rel=\"stylesheet\" href=\"KDE_COMMON_DIR/kde-default.css\" type=\"text/css\">\n" );
+                    out_html( "<meta http-equiv=\"Content-Type\" content=\"text/html; charset=" );
+		    out_html( QTextCodec::codecForLocale()->mimeName() );
+		    out_html(  "\">\n" );
                     out_html( "</HEAD>\n\n" );
                     out_html("<BODY BGCOLOR=\"#FFFFFF\">\n\n" );
                     out_html("<div id=\"headline\" style=\"position : absolute; height : 85px; z-index :\n" );
 
design & coding: Vladimir Lettiev aka crux © 2004-2005